Output 43cdc53360a2fc5c75d07963c7295b2102779ce62fd6ffbf0840177a2fad48fb:0

value
35650438
script pubkey
OP_0 OP_PUSHBYTES_20 a29e44f5554244543c894a8f9c9d3776168ccdad
address
bc1q520yfa24gfz9g0yff28ee8fhwctgenddvlm2v9
transaction
43cdc53360a2fc5c75d07963c7295b2102779ce62fd6ffbf0840177a2fad48fb
spent
true